All ProctorLine queue-worker images are built in the sealed Varnholt pipeline and signed before promotion. Reviewers should confirm that the deployed artifact matches the attestation record, since the exam-proctoring queue handles candidate session events and must never run unverified code. Rollbacks reuse previously attested images only; ad-hoc builds are rejected at admission. Provenance checks run on every deploy, and failures page the Trustline rotation immediately. The attested build for the current deployment is recorded below.

pipeline stamp: htk21_104c5ba7d0df6b2897cd5

Team — quick update on the Fernlight launch. We're locking the go-live for the first week of next quarter, with branch demo kits shipping two weeks prior. Branch managers: please block staff training slots now, not later. Marketing collateral from the Opaline studio lands Friday. Pricing is final; no regional exceptions this round. One thing to keep close to the chest follows.

board note of bawep-tajef: Queniusek Systems plans to raise the Quenvan list price by 53.1 percent in March. The pricing group signed off on a budget of $176.4 million for Project Drueth. The renewal with Casionix Partners closes at $142.5 million a year, 8.3 percent below the last contract. Project Fraax slips by six weeks because of the tooling delay.

Hi all,

As of next sprint, ownership of the bulk-edit feature in the Ledgerline admin table is moving. This covers the multi-row selection logic, the optimistic update queue, and the undo window that reverts batched changes within sixty seconds. Future maintainers should note that the audit trail writes happen asynchronously, so any refactor must preserve ordering guarantees there. Please route review requests, incident follow-ups, and design proposals for this area to the new owner named below.

named custodian: Quenael Briax

**Q: Does Confluxa support hot-reloading of configuration, and what should we tell customers when a reload fails?**

A: Yes, Confluxa watches its config directory and applies changes without a restart. If a reload fails validation, the previous config stays active and an alert fires. Walk the customer through fixing the syntax error first. If the watcher itself has crashed, they must re-initialize it, which requires entering the recovery passphrase:

recovery phrase for fajeg-hagug: holox-fenmir